Определите области в объекте, загруженном с использованием OBJLoader2 Три js - PullRequest
0 голосов
/ 26 сентября 2019

У меня есть изображение, для которого я создал файл .obj, используя blender, а затем загрузил его, используя OBJLoader2, чтобы показать его в сцене (см. здесь ).Но мне нужно идентифицировать различные области в этой форме, такие как задняя, ​​передняя, ​​левая, правая и т. Д., И скрывать показанные части объекта в зависимости от того, какая сторона находится перед камерой.

Так для ветряной мельницы в приведенном выше примере( отдельный вид ), если я поверну вправо, он должен исчезнуть с правой стороны и показать внутреннюю часть ветряной мельницы, а также внутренние стены слева, спереди и сзади. Здесь - пример того, что я пытаюсь воспроизвести.

Я использую blender для извлечения файла .blend, который возвращает мне файлы .mtl и .obj.Могу ли я добавить некоторую информацию в файл .blend, относящуюся к разным частям изображения, перед его извлечением?И использовать эту информацию позже в течение трех секунд, чтобы идентифицировать эти части изображения с помощью Ray Caster?

...